Boom of EV and how can India beat it's competition? (Part-2) Well in any industry, there is a start product which makes up the most of the system, here we have lithium which is used to make cathode of the battery. Here location where lithium is found is very critical to geopolitics. 96% of the world's lithium is found in four countries which are- Australia - 52% Chile - 25% China - 13% Argentina - 6% Even though Australia has more lithium than China, they can not ship it directly to the world because lithium can't be sold directly, it first has to go through processing method. Due to the lack of high tech machinaries which China has, they gained the power of Australian's high value product. Only because of this Australia ship approximately 90% of their lithium ores to China. Now we will see how China dominates this market globally later.
